Global Hospital-Acquired Infections Market size was valued at USD 30.4 billion in 2023 and is poised to grow from USD 30.86 billion in 2024 to USD 34.76 billion by 2032, growing at a CAGR of 1.5% during the forecast period (2025-2032).
The infection control market is witnessing robust growth driven by heightened awareness of Hospital Acquired Infections (HAIs), the urgent need to combat cross infections, and the rising prevalence of infectious diseases within healthcare facilities. Key products such as sterilization equipment, cleaning and disinfection agents, protective barriers, and endoscope reprocessing tools play crucial roles in minimizing hospital-acquired infections. Additionally, supportive government initiatives advocating for improved infection control measures further bolster this sector. The adoption of comprehensive infection prevention guidelines at hospital, regional, and national levels, along with the growing integration of monitoring technologies, are significant factors fueling market expansion. As awareness and compliance grow, the demand for effective infection control products and services continues to rise, making this a dynamic and vital market space.

Global Hospital-Acquired Infections Market Segmental Analysis
Global Hospital-Acquired Infections Market is segmented by Type, Treatment, Infection Type, End User and region. Based on Type, the market is segmented into Equipment, Consumables and Services. Based on Treatment, the market is segmented into Antibacterial, Antiviral, Antifungal and Others. Based on Infection Type, the market is segmented into Bloodstream Infections, Ventilator-Associated Pneumonia (VAP), Urinary Tract Infection, Surgical-Site Infection, Gastrointestinal Infections and Others. Based on End User, the market is segmented into Hospitals & Clinics, Ambulatory Surgical Centers and Others. Based on region, the market is segmented into North America, Europe, Asia Pacific, Latin America and Middle East & Africa.
Driver of the Global Hospital-Acquired Infections Market
The Global Hospital-Acquired Infections market is poised for growth driven by the rising number of surgical procedures performed globally. According to the World Health Organization, approximately 235 million major surgeries are carried out annually, a trend fueled by the increasing prevalence of obesity, lifestyle-related diseases, an aging population, and a surge in spine and sports injuries. As more surgeries take place, the demand for surgical tools and medical devices escalates. The recognized advantages of sterilized equipment, coupled with heightened awareness of their importance in healthcare environments, are expected to significantly boost the demand for services addressing hospital-acquired infections.
Restraints in the Global Hospital-Acquired Infections Market
The growth of the Global Hospital-Acquired Infections market is hindered by apprehensions surrounding the safety of reprocessed medical instruments. While reusing devices like surgical forceps, endoscopes, and stethoscopes can significantly reduce costs and environmental waste for healthcare providers, doubts persist regarding the efficacy and cleanliness of these reprocessed items. Improper cleaning and sterilization processes might leave behind blood, tissue, and other biological residue, elevating the risk of surgical-site infections (SSIs) and hospital-acquired infections (HAIs). Furthermore, any residual materials, such as chemical disinfectants, could lead to tissue irritation. This uncertainty is resulting in limited acceptance of device reprocessing among hospital administrators and clinicians.
Market Trends of the Global Hospital-Acquired Infections Market
The Global Hospital-Acquired Infections (HAIs) market is experiencing significant growth, propelled by a surge in chronic diseases like diabetes, cardiovascular disorders, and gastrointestinal conditions. With environmental and lifestyle factors contributing to rising disease prevalence-projected to escalate from 537 million diabetics in 2021 to approximately 783 million by 2045-there will be an uptick in surgical procedures, consequently elevating the risk of HAIs. Increased awareness and need for stringent sterilization and disinfection protocols will further drive demand for infection control devices. As such, the market is poised for robust expansion, addressing both the rise in surgical interventions and the necessity for enhanced infection prevention measures.
